It is worth exploring whatAvengers: Infinity War’s opening scene was and what it achieved. The film opens with a distress call being sent out by the Asgardian ship fromThor: Ragnarok’s ending before showing Thanos' children, the Black Order, stalking over countless dead bodies. Thanos then appears for the first time, handling the most powerful Avenger like a rag doll.
Thanos defeats a hero like Thor beforeAvengers: Infinity Wareven begins, showing how powerful he truly is. He then fights the Hulk, easily dispatching the Avenger with the most raw, brute strength.The scene ends with Thanos killing Heimdall and Loki before leaving Thor to die, solidifying just how powerful he is as an MCU villainin only the film’s opening.

Interestingly,The Fantastic Four: First Stepsteased what the opening scene ofAvengers: Doomsdaycould be. This tease came in the form of the former’s post-credit scene, which linked to Franklin Richards. Theending ofThe Fantastic Four: First Stepsproved just how powerful Franklin Richards is, with this power being something that Doom is seemingly seeking for himself.
Doom clearly wants Franklin Richards for something, withDoomsdayneeding to outline exactly what…
In the film’s post-credit scene, Doom can be seen kneeling in front of Franklin. The latter touches the former’s scarred face, with the iconic metal mask of Doctor Doom facing towards the camera. As Sue Storm witnesses this, the scene cuts to black, and the words “The Fantastic Four will return inAvengers: Doomsday"appear on-screen.
After this scene, it is difficult to imagineAvengers: Doomsdaystarting anywhere other than here. Doom clearly wants Franklin Richards for something, withDoomsdayneeding to outline exactly what. Therefore, if the aftermath of this scene is shown inAvengers: Doomsday’s opening, it could repeat the aforementioned Thanos scene with a new twist.

If this theory comes true andAvengers: Doomsday’s opening picks up immediately afterThe Fantastic Four: First Steps' post-credit scene, Doom’s threat as a villain can be shown immediately, just as Thanos' was. If Doom does want Franklin and tries to kidnap him, Sue, Reed, Johnny, and Ben are not simply going to let this happen.
This could mean thatAvengers: Doomsdaystarts with Doom defeating The Fantastic Four with relative ease and taking Franklin with him. This would be an excellent way to tease Doom’s motivations, give The Fantastic Four a reason to be involved in the fight against him, and establish the villain as one of Marvel’s most powerful via his defeat of four strong heroes.
If Doom does all of this and flees the universe, perhaps to Earth-616,Avengers: Doomsdaywould begin with the same impact that Thanos had onAvengers: Infinity War. After all, Thanos did defeat several established heroes, escape with an important plot McGuffin, and flee into space. Doom could do the same, only this time after defeating The Fantastic Four.
